CRACRAFT, Judge.

Ferman and Ernestine Ward appeal from a judgment entered against them in favor of Robert and Vonda Russell, in the amount of $22,725.00 for breach of implied warranties in new housing. Appellants contend that the trial court erred in failing to give their proffered instruction on waiver of the breach. We find no error and affirm.
